This is a staple to the Queen St West restaurant scene. The decor of Shanghai Cowgirl is very diner-esque, and all the waitresses resemble 50's pinups with all their tattoos. I have eaten here twice, the first time i had a philly cheese steak and it was quite good. The second time i went with a large group of friends and they all ordered breakfast and none were too happy with what they got. The sausages were really greasy, and the french toast was hardly soaked in eggs and very dry. I had the lox which was your standard however it was over 10 dollars which i find really expensive for a bagel, cream cheese and smoked salmon. However i really love the vibe of this place and will definetely go back.
